H04L12/413

Coexistence primitives in power line communication networks

Systems and methods for setting a carrier-sensing mechanism in a PLC node are disclosed. In a PLC standard, coexistence is achieved by having the nodes detect a common preamble and backing off by a Coexistence InterFrame Space (cEIFS) time period to help the node to avoid interfering with the other technologies. In one embodiment, a PHY primitive is sent from the PHY to the MAC know that there has been a preamble detection. A two-level indication may be used—one indication after receiving the preamble and other indication after decoding the entire frame. The MAC sets the carrier-sensing mechanism based on the preamble detection.

Method and apparatus for transmitting service flow based on flexible ethernet, and communication system
11496405 · 2022-11-08 · ·

A method and apparatus for transmitting a service flow based on a flexible Ethernet, where a bandwidth resource corresponding to a bundling group (BG) of a flexible Ethernet is divided into M timeslots, service data of a service flow is encapsulated in N timeslots in the M timeslots, and the method includes: when a first PHY in the BG fails, determining, based on a preconfigured first timeslot configuration table (TCT), a target timeslot (TTS) in the N timeslots that is mapped to the first PHY; searching the M timeslots for an idle timeslot (ITS) based on the first TCT; adjusting the first TCT when a quantity of ITSs is greater than or equal to a quantity of TTSs, so that all the N timeslots are mapped to PHYs other than the first PHY; and transmitting the service flow by using the mapped PHYs of the bundling group.

Method of a communication system having a control device and a relay device

A method includes: (a) transmitting, by the control device, control data containing one of the plurality of second parameters to the relay device; (b) determining, by at least one of the control device or the relay device, whether the one of the plurality of second parameters matches one of the plurality of first parameters; and (c) transmitting, by the relay device, the control data received from the control device in (a), using one of the plurality of interfaces of the relay device for which the one of the plurality of second parameters is set if it is determined in the determining that the one of the plurality of first parameters matches the one of the plurality of second parameters.

Information transmission method and apparatus, and communication device

Provided are an information transmission method and apparatus, and a communication device. The method comprises: a first device entity acquiring header information of an Ethernet data packet from a second device entity, wherein the header information of the Ethernet data packet comprises first indication information, and the first indication information is used for indicating whether the header information of the Ethernet data packet includes a target information domain.

SCALABLE SECURE SPEED NEGOTIATION FOR TIME-SENSITIVE NETWORKING DEVICES
20230098298 · 2023-03-30 · ·

A driver of an Ethernet controller may determine, based on an interrupt received from a PHY circuit coupled to the Ethernet controller, that a connection between the PHY circuit and a remote device was established using auto-negotiation over a physical communication medium. The driver may determine a speed of the connection. The driver may, based on a determination that the speed of the connection is not a first predetermined speed, enable auto-negotiation between the PHY circuit and the Ethernet controller to establish a link at a second speed that is different than the first predetermined speed.

Computational accelerator for storage operations

A system includes a host processor, which has a host memory and is coupled to store data in a non-volatile memory in accordance with a storage protocol. A network interface controller (NIC) receives data packets conveyed over a packet communication network from peer computers containing, in payloads of the data packets, data records that encode data in accordance with the storage protocol for storage in the non-volatile memory. The NIC processes the data records in the data packets that are received in order in each flow from a peer computer and extracts and writes the data to the host memory, and when a data packet arrives out of order, writes the data packet to the host memory without extracting the data and processes the data packets in the flow so as to recover context information for use in processing the data records in subsequent data packets in the flow.

Multidrop network system and network device

A multidrop network system includes N network devices. The N network devices include a master device and multiple slave devices, and each network device has an identification code as its own identification in the multidrop network system. The N network devices have N identification codes and obtain transmission opportunities in turn according to the N identification codes in each round of data transmission. Each network device performs a count operation to generate a current count value, and when the identification code of a network device is the same as the current count value, this network device obtains a transmission opportunity. After a device obtains the transmission opportunity, it determines whether a cut-in signal from another network device is observed in a front duration of a predetermined time slot, and then determines whether to abandon/defer the right to start transmitting in the remaining duration of the predetermined time slot.

SLAVE DEVICE, BUS SYSTEM, AND METHODS

A method and slave devices are disclosed in which an address assignment to slave devices takes place with the aid of a collision detection.

SLAVE DEVICE, BUS SYSTEM, AND METHODS

A method and slave devices are disclosed in which an address assignment to slave devices takes place with the aid of a collision detection.

LOW COMPLEXITY ETHERNET NODE (LEN) ONE PORT
20220350773 · 2022-11-03 ·

A network interface module for coupling a host device to a switched network as a network node is described. The network interface module comprises a single half-duplex port for communicatively coupling to a shared bus of the switched network, at least one frame queue sized to store one multicast read frame received via the shared bus, and logic circuitry. The logic circuitry is configured to decode a read command for the interface module included in a payload of the multicast read frame that includes multiple read commands for other network nodes of the switched network, and transmit a response frame including read data on the shared bus when detecting the shared bus is available for transmitting.